Weir Farm, Edale Road, Hope Hope Valley, S33 6ZF

Price: £900,000

A gorgeous and beautifully restored farmhouse with an ancillary annexe for a dependent relative found on the other side of the yard, full planning permission granted to extend the main building (NP/HPK/0906/0829 – Restoration of existing cottage and two storey side extension) to provide further accommodation, further associated outbuildings/stables/garage offering potential and approx. 3.75 acres of attached grazing land, accessible from the top of the drive, and ideal for equestrian pursuits. This property enjoys an enviable location on the outskirts of the village of Hope, close to the local shops, pubs, cafes and restaurants that combine to make the village such a sought-after part of The Hope Valley to live and conveniently offers commuters speedy train links into both Sheffield and Manchester’s city centres via the Peak Rail service. The property will be ideal for those buyers who wish to have direct access to a generous amount of grazing land and perhaps have dependent relatives to accommodate in the annexe or who may prefer to use this unit as a way of boosting their income via utilising it as an Air bnb/holiday cottage (subject to permissions). The ongoing planning approval to further extend the property, will make this opportunity perfect for a buyer who wishes to invest further and add their own requirements to the main residence and provide additional living space for a growing family.
